Position Summary

RT Specialty is a leading wholesale distributor of specialty insurance products and services. Our experienced brokers are specialized in property, casualty, professional lines, transportation and workers' compensation, providing creative solutions to retail brokerage firms. We define ourselves through our superior execution on behalf of our clients, which has established us as a leader in the industry.

As an independent wholesale broker, we are a critical intermediary in the distribution channel from insurance carriers and retail brokers. This Account Executive serves as a strategic partner to internal teams by staying informed on market trends and providing actionable insights into client needs and behaviors. Through close collaboration, the individual helps shape client strategies and supports decision-making with relevant market intelligence.

The Account Executive is responsible for assisting the Broker team in executing trades, managing accounts, and navigating regulatory compliance. The role collaborates with internal teams, stays informed on market trends, and offers strategic insights about clients. They are also responsible for assisting in new business and renewal submissions, reviewing policy documents and invoices and other client service activities.

This role is 100% on site, in our Phoenix, AZ office with 5 days required in office weekly (5410 East High Street, Suite 200 Phoenix, AZ 85054)

What will your job entail?

  • Prepares accounts for new business and renewals as directed by the broker, initiating renewal reviews to optimize client coverage and recommending strategies for client retention.

  • Assists brokers in developing market submissions and quote cover letters, while reviewing incoming documents for accuracy and completeness.

  • Builds strong relationships with brokers and demonstrates a solid understanding of brokerage operations to proactively support evolving business needs.

  • Partners with brokers to drive renewal activity and generate new business opportunities through client referrals.

  • Collaborates on new business strategies, including the development of proposals and presentations for prospective clients.

  • Evaluates account-related risks and ensures compliance with industry regulations and internal policies.

  • Maintains accurate client data in internal systems, produces clear documentation, and adheres to defined guidelines and service standards.

  • Generates performance and portfolio trend reports using data and insights to support broker decision-making and enhance the book of business.

  • Coordinates with internal teams to fulfill contractual obligations, resolves invoicing issues with Premium Accounting, and manages notices of cancellation.

What will you bring?

  • Minimum of 2-4 years of Property & Casualty experience in the commercial insurance industry

  • Bachelor's degree required; preferred fields include Business Administration, Sales, or Risk Management. Other related disciplines or equivalent work experience will be considered.

Licenses and Certifications:

  • Prescribed: Minimum requirements for state Property & Casualty (P&C) and/or surplus lines licenses.

  • Preferred: Certified Insurance Service Representative (CISR), Commercial Insurance License (CIL).
